
Ford Philippines is expanding its presence nationwide by launching its first-ever mobile showroom designed to bring the dealership experience directly to the community. It aims to reach more customers in areas not typically covered by a physical showroom, especially in high-traffic and high-growth locations.
The showroom on-the-go is part of Ford's customer-first promise—bringing the brand and consumers closer to where they are. Here, interested customers can explore the latest vehicles, speak with product experts, test drive, and avail exclusive offers more easily and more personally.
The Ford mobile showroom will first stop in Balanga City, Bataan from January 26 to February 2, 2026, in partnership with Ford Subic. According to management, this is the first activation of its kind for Ford in the Philippines—an innovative step in creating a curated experience for urban communities.
A Ford Ranger pulls a mobile showroom trailer weighing more than 2.5 tons, demonstrating the pickup's towing capacity, power, and capability. At the event itself, those who reserve a vehicle will have exclusive benefits such as cash discount, full tank of gas, and other premium incentives, while those who participate in the test drive will receive Ford merchandise.
